This book examines the effects of ecotourism on Indigenous peoples chronicling the costs and benefits of ecotourism from a comparative and anthropological perspective.
Author Biography
Wayne A. Babchuk is professor in the Quantitative, Qualitative, and Psychometric Methods (QQPM) program in the Department of Educational Psychology at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ln.
Robert K. Hitchcock is professor in the Department of Anthropology at the University of New Mexico.
